14:22 — Offline sync regression confirmed (Terrapath field-survey app)

At 14:22 the on-call engineer reproduced the data-loss path: surveys saved while offline were marked synced once connectivity returned, even when the upload was rejected. The queue flush skipped the server acknowledgement check introduced in the previous sprint. Release manager note: the fix must ship before the coastal survey season. The offending build is identified by the token recorded below.

session token of kawif-fawig = htk31_f3f599be2b1a34affb1efa8d0feccf8

Subject: On-call primer — undo/redo in SketchLoft

Hi, welcome to the rotation. SketchLoft's diagram editor keeps undo and redo state in a per-session command stack, so a crash can orphan half-applied operations. If users report "redo does nothing," check the stack reconciler logs before restarting anything — restarts wipe pending commands. Most incidents resolve by replaying the command journal. The full reconciliation procedure, including edge cases, is documented on our internal page.

dashboard of bafof-hafog = https://confluence.lumiclabs.internal/display/browse/display/6a09a20a

The fan-out backpressure control in Plumewire Notify, formerly FANOUT_THROTTLE, is now FANOUT_BACKPRESSURE_LIMIT to match the queueing semantics introduced in 2.8. Support should note: the old name is ignored silently, so customers upgrading without editing their env file will see unbounded fan-out and delivery spikes. Walk them through renaming the key and restarting the dispatcher. While they have the .env open, confirm the dispatcher's signing credential is present — it belongs on the line immediately after the renamed setting.

env line for fafof-fahag: LEDGER_TOKEN5=f8790